EaseMyTrip to launch five-star hotel in Ayodhya with INR 100 crore investment
EaseMyTrip is set to enter the hospitality business with the board of the online travel aggregator approving the proposal to open a five-star hotel in Ayodhya, close to the vicinity of Ram Temple, which was inaugurated on January 22.
The company said in a statement, "The Board of Directors (“Board”) of Easy Trip Planners Limited (“Company”) in its meeting held today, i.e., on February 11, 2024, has, inter alia considered and in-principally approved the proposal to open a 5-star hotel in Ayodhya which is less then 1Km from Shree Ram Mandir through an investment of an amount of up to ₹100 crores in Jeewani Hospitality Private Limited, a company under incorporation for 50% of the aggregate share capital of the said company on a fully diluted basis through swap i.e., fresh issuance of the Company’s own equity shares on preferential basis."
Meanwhile, EaseMyTrip reported a 9.6 increase in net profit at ₹45.6 crore in the December quarter of FY24 up from ₹41.69 crore during the same period a year ago on the back of robust growth in travel demand.
